Summary

The problem here is that util.normpath() calls util.pconvert(), which
switches to Unix style separators. That results in two test failures like this
since 5685ce2ea3bf:

    • c:/Users/Matt/hg/tests/test-globalopts.t +++ c:/Users/Matt/hg/tests/test-globalopts.t.err @@ -89,7 +89,7 @@ [255] $ hg -R b ann a/a abort: a/a not under root '$TESTTMP/b'
  • (consider using '--cwd b') + (consider using '--cwd ..\$TESTTMP\b') [255] $ hg log abort: no repository found in '$TESTTMP' (.hg not found)!

    ERROR: test-globalopts.t output changed

Martin originally had os.path.normpath() (which *would* work here too), but
changed it during review. He didn't remember why he thought any form is needed
here. Most uses simply pass '' or repo.getcwd(), so these should generally be
in local format anyway. It seems better if cwd and root use consistent
styles here.
